Explanation:
Aspheric lenses are designed with a curved profile that changes gradually from the center to the edges, rather than maintaining a constant spherical shape. This design allows them to reduce distortion and improve image quality compared to traditional spherical lenses. A flatter profile not only enhances aesthetics by creating a thinner lens but also helps to correct vision more effectively, particularly for higher prescriptions. Aspheric lenses minimize peripheral distortion, enabling clearer vision across the entire lens surface, which is especially beneficial for individuals with certain vision impairments.
